Output 6edc40b75f36a22a30e251131e6e156e6ef19e2a0610f61112de79fefbe1c78c:0

value
2357740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ae85fcf955b688f77bc279d0501c3e50456ebee5 OP_EQUAL
address
3Hbp1aqQTAvmqwXhBc5zbA5msaPRV7RUdP
transaction
6edc40b75f36a22a30e251131e6e156e6ef19e2a0610f61112de79fefbe1c78c
confirmations
335117
spent
true